ARA 290 peptide (also written as ARA-290) is a synthetic peptide derived from the tertiary structure of erythropoietin (EPO), a hormone primarily known for its role in red blood cell production. Unlike EPO, ARA 290 has been designed to harness tissue-protective and repair-related signaling properties without stimulating erythropoiesis.
Preclinical and early clinical research suggests ara 290 may support anti-inflammatory pathways, promote cellular repair mechanisms, and protect various tissues from stress-related damage. Characteristics
| Molecular Formula | C51H84N16O21 |
| CAS | 1208243-50-8 |
| Molar Mass | 1686.97 g/mol |
| Chemical Formula | C51H84N16O21 |
| Amino Acid Sequence | Pyr-Glu-Gln-Leu-Glu-Arg-Ala-Leu-Asn-Ser-Ser |
| Synonyms | Pyroglutamate Helix B Surface Peptide, pHBSP, ARA 290, Cibinetide |
| Solubility | Water-soluble |
| Organoleptic Profile | White to off-white powder |
| Composition | Lyophilized powder - requires reconstitution |
How does ARA-290 work?
ARA-290 exerts its effects by selectively activating the innate repair receptor (IRR), a heteromeric complex composed of EPO receptor (EPOR) and β common receptor (βcR) subunits. This specific interaction triggers a cascade of signaling events that lead to anti-inflammatory, tissue-protective, and repair-promoting effects. ARA-290 has been shown to modulate the immune response by reducing the production of pro-inflammatory cytokines and increasing the expression of anti-inflammatory mediators. Additionally, it promotes the survival and function of various cell types, including endothelial cells, cardiomyocytes, and neurons, under stress conditions.
ARA 290 Peptide Benefits
Studies investigating ara 290 peptide benefits suggest potential activity across multiple biological systems:
- Neuroprotection: ARA-290 has demonstrated neuroprotective properties in models of spinal cord injury, traumatic brain injury, and ischemic stroke, reducing neuronal damage and promoting functional recovery.
- Cardioprotection: Studies have shown that ARA-290 can protect the heart from ischemia-reperfusion injury, reduce infarct size, and improve cardiac function in animal models of myocardial infarction.
- Renal protection: ARA-290 has been found to attenuate renal injury and improve kidney function in preclinical models of acute kidney injury and chronic kidney disease.
- Anti-inflammatory effects: The peptide exhibits potent anti-inflammatory properties, reducing the production of pro-inflammatory cytokines and promoting the resolution of inflammation in various tissues.
- Wound healing: ARA-290 has been shown to accelerate wound healing and promote tissue repair in animal models of skin, corneal, and intestinal injuries.
- Pain relief: Clinical studies have demonstrated that ARA-290 can effectively reduce neuropathic pain in patients with sarcoidosis and type 2 diabetes mellitus.
ARA 290 Side Effects
Available clinical data suggest ara 290 side effects are minimal and that the compound has been generally well tolerated in controlled trials.
Importantly, unlike erythropoietin, ARA 290 peptide does not stimulate red blood cell production, which may reduce risks associated with erythropoiesis, such as thrombotic complications. However, as with all research compounds, further long-term evaluation is required.
